Space didn't reclaim after moving volume to other aggregate

Applies to

  • ONTAP 9
  • Volume Move
  • Fabricpool

Answer

  • It is because the volume is a fabricpool volume, 90% of the user data is tiered to object-store/cold tier.
  • Data in object-store will not occupy aggregate space, thus moving fabricpool volume from one aggregate to other will not reclaim all the space but only reclaim space which is in performance tier/local tier.
 
Example:
  • If the volume used size is 2.28TB, out of which 2.15TB is in cold tier/object-store.
  • So only 130GB is in local tier or being occupied in aggregate.
Volume show-footprint:

Volume : vol_test

      Feature                                           Used      Used%
      --------------------------------      ----------------      -----
      Volume Data Footprint                           2.28TB        16%
         Footprint in Performance Tier                 132GB         6%
         Footprint in StorageAccount                  2.15TB        94%
      Flexible Volume Metadata                        15.6GB         0%
      Deduplication Metadata                          12.7GB         0%
         Deduplication                                12.7GB         0%
      Delayed Frees                                   97.1MB         0%
      Total                                           2.31TB        16%

      Effective Total Footprint                       2.31TB        16%
      

  • If vol move is performed, aggregate will only reclaim 130GB of space not whole 2.28TB.
  • Reason, 2.15TB is in cold tier which doesn't consume space from aggregate.
